First the easy part-- stopped by Druid Ridge briefly today from 11 to 12. No sign of the White-winged Crossbills by myself or anyone else this morning. I hope people continue to post sightings as I plan on continuing my attempts at seeing them (fourth try today).


I drove to Ocean City on Saturday 1/24/2009 and birded the inlet and Elliot Pond, as well as another inlet to the north. Overall, good variety. The highlight was a single female COMMON EIDER at the end of the jetty. I also had a possible LITTLE GULL, but the look was brief as it flew out toward the ocean. It appeared to have dark under wings, but I would have preferred a better look before laying claim.
